One of our community engagement partnerships is building relationships with folks recovering from chronic homelessness out at Community First Village. We’re hosting a monthly Taco Tuesday dinner and finding other creative ways to get to know these amazing people. By showing up again and again for folks who have often been forced to the margins, we build trust and felt safety which are crucial to the healing process.

Dustin & Christina Hite, fellow ANC’ers who live at the Village as intentional neighbors commented, “We believe that being a faithful presence is a slow, intentional practice of allowing God to work in and through our lives as we go about our days. We create environments that are welcoming to all and centered on the ways of Jesus. ANC can help build on that relational momentum and have a blast listening to the rich stories of our neighbors!”

OUT YOUTH

Out Youth serves Central Texas LGBTQIA+ (lesbian/gay/bisexual, transgender, queer and questioning, intersex, and asexual) youth and their allies with programs and services to ensure these promising young people develop into happy, healthy, successful adults.

Founded in 1990, Out Youth has grown and changed over the years, but we’ve always retained our most important facet – providing a safe space for LGBTQ+ youth to come together, receive support, and make friends who understand who they are.

We host a variety of programs and services for youth and provide trainings and resources for parents, teachers, and community members.
